Q:   How do I get admission to Ahmedabad University BTech course?
A: 

Admission to Ahmedabad University's BTech Chemical Engineering, BTech Mechanical Engineering, and BTech Computer Science and Engineering programs are allocated based on JEE (Main) scores for students who are not from Gujarat. Gujarat domiciled students can apply for these courses through a valid score of GUJCET. Ahmedabad University fills 50% of seats directly through an online application based on the JEE Main All India Rank, while the remaining 50% of seats are allocated through the Admission Committee for Professional Courses (ACPC) via GUJCET. ACPC is a Gujarat-state committee responsible for the admission of candidates in Engineering courses across all the state universities of Gujarat. Students are invited for group counselling based on the merit list.

Q:   I want to get admission in UV Patel College, Gujarat. What should I do to get admission there?
A: 

In order to secure an admission in U.V. Patel College of Engineering (UVPCE), which is a constituent college of Ganpat University in Gujarat, you are mainly required to qualify through relevant entrance examinations. In the case of B.E/B.Tech, there is a requirement of valid score in JEE Main or GUJCET. You should have also cleared 10+2 with Physics, Mathematics and one between Chemistry/Biology/Biotechnology/ Technological Vocation with an aggregate minimum of 45% aggregate (40% of reserved category). The entry will then be via counselling by the ACPC (Admission Committee for Professional Courses) on the basis of your ranks in exams. In the case of the PG courses, such as M.E./M.Tech, there are usually expected: a valid GATE score as well as a Bachelor degree with a 50 percent aggregate.

Q:   Can Electronics Engineer become a professor after pursuing B.Tech?
A: 

Yes, Candidates who wish to become a professor after BTech in Electrical Engineering will also be required to complete MTech and PhD in the required discipline.They must clear GATE in order to pursue M.Tech and later pursue PhD in the same discipline. They must demonstrate excellent research skills by grabbing fellowships and submitting research papers across SCOPUS indexed journals.
